Foxboro Evo Control HMI 
Standard Situational Awareness Library provides: 
Color reserved for 
alarms 
Process lines 
muted 
Devices & status 
indicators in grey 
& white 
Non-control 
essential items 
removed from HMI 
Analogue 
indicators 
Triple coding of 
alarms

HMI Design Process – Mapping 
- Provides organized views of plant operation and 
performance at multiple levels – operator can “drill 
down” to desired amount of detail 
- Customized overview graphics connect the 
operator to the overall process goals 
- Reveal the relationships between high-level goals 
and detailed process operational states
